HAIVRIOT
HaIvriot is an Israeli female supergroup featuring nine of the country’s most prominent musicians. Each member is an acclaimed artist in her own right, appearing in Israel’s largest productions and maintaining successful solo careers.
The Ensemble:
●Karni Postel: Cello
●Vered Picker: Piano
●Galia Hai: Viola
●Ola Shor Selektar: Glockenspiel & Poetry Reading
●Raz Shmueli: Classical Guitar
●Roni Wagner: Drums & Percussion
●Alex Moshe: Electric Guitar
●Salit Lahav: Accordion, Woodwinds, Synthesizer
●Shani Shavit: Bass Guitar
Together, these women perform songs which constitute the "beating heart" of Hebrew culture. While each member brings a unique musical "color" and independent voice, their collaboration results in a refreshing, powerful, and unified musical language. Every vocal and instrumental arrangement is a collective creation of the ensemble.
Flagship Performances
HaIvriot offers four distinct productions, each centered on a legendary Israeli creator. These 80-minute shows blend beloved classics with short interludes of recited poetry.
1. Leah G: The Songs of Leah Goldberg
A journey through the timeless works of one of Israel’s most beloved poets. This show features Goldberg’s iconic lyrics set to both classic and contemporary melodies. Though written decades ago, these texts remain startlingly relevant today.
2. Shoshana D: A Tribute to Shoshana Damari
Inspired by the "Queen of Hebrew Music," this performance celebrates the majesty of Shoshana Damari. With a voice that echoed the ancient spirit of Canaan while radiating Hollywood glamour, Damari brought the spirit of the Levant to the world stage. Haivriot offers soaring new arrangements of her greatest hits.
3. Nathan A: The Poetry of Nathan Alterman
A unique female interpretation of Alterman’s legendary repertoire. These are songs of love, rebuke, beauty, and pain—many of which were written for the influential women in his life: his wife Rachel Marcus, his lover Tzilla Binder, and his daughter Tirza Atar.
4. New Show! Ehud M: The Work of Ehud Manor
After six years of performing together, HaIvriot reaches a new artistic peak with this tribute to Ehud Manor. The show highlights Manor’s moving, wise, and quintessentially Israeli body of work—both original lyrics and masterful translations. The maturity of the ensemble creates a rich, sophisticated musical fabric.
